首页 > web前端 > js教程 > 20个基本反应工具

20个基本反应工具

William Shakespeare
发布: 2025-02-10 12:49:13
原创
579 人浏览过

20 Essential React Tools

React生态系统拥有大量的开发人员工具和库,反映了其巨大的知名度。 这种丰度可能是压倒性的,因此本指南强调了2020年及以后的有效反应开发的基本工具,技术和技能。

>

键突出显示:

    钩子:
  • 现代反应的基础,在功能组件中实现状态和生命周期管理,消除了对课堂的需求。 创建React App:
  • 通过捆绑基本工具和配置来简化项目设置。
  • >键入安全性(proptypes&tyspript):
  • >通过类型检查增强代码质量; PropTypes提供运行时验证,而TypeScript提供静态类型检查。>
  • 状态管理(redux&context api): redux仍然是复杂应用程序的强大解决方案,但是React的Context API为更简单的需求提供了更轻的替代方案。 >
  • React路由器:
  • >在单页应用程序中导航至关重要,确保UI-url同步。 >
  • > REACT开发人员工具:一个关键的浏览器扩展程序,可深入了解组件树和性能。
  • >详细的工具分解:
  • (注意:每个工具的详细描述是为了简洁而省略的,但原始文本提供了全面的信息。此响应着重于重组和释义。
    • >挂钩(USESTATE,USEFEFFECT,USECONTEXT):功能组件中的简化状态管理和副作用。>
    • >
    • 功能组件:创建反应组件的首选方法,强调声明性的样式和改进的可测试性。>
    • >创建React App:自动进行React Project Boottagping,处理依赖项和配置的首选工具。
    • > >代理服务器:
    • 在开发和部署过程中促进与后端API的无缝集成,简化API调用并避免CORS问题。
    • > proptypes:
    • 提供了运行时类型检查组件道具,增强代码清晰度并捕获潜在错误。
    • typescript:
    • 添加静态类型检查到JavaScript,提高代码可维护性和可伸缩性。 redux&react-redux:用于复杂应用的稳健状态管理解决方案,react-redux提供了与React组件无缝集成。
  • > React路由器: react的标准路由库,启用导航和URL同步。
  • > eslint:一种伸长工具,确保一致的代码样式并确定潜在的问题。 > lodash:>一个实用程序库为常见任务提供有用的功能,例如辩论事件。
  • axios:强大的http客户端简化了数据获取和保存。
  • > 开玩笑:一个重点是简单性和易用性的测试框架,通常与Create React App集成。
  • 酶和浅渲染器:对反应组件的测试实用程序,为测试复杂性提供了不同的方法。>
  • 故事书:一种用于隔离开发和测试UI组件的工具。
  • > React Bootstrap&Material-ui:流行的UI组件库,分别提供基于引导和材料设计的预构建组件和样式。>
  • >
  • React DevTools:用于检查和调试React应用程序的必不可少的浏览器扩展。 很棒的反应:
  • React生态系统的策划资源列表。
  • 结论:
  • React生态系统提供了满足各种需求的丰富工具。 选择正确的工具取决于项目复杂性和开发人员的偏好。 探索这些工具将大大增强您的反应开发工作流程。 (简洁而省略了常见问题,但原始文本提供了答案。)

    20 Essential React Tools 20 Essential React Tools

以上是20个基本反应工具的详细内容。更多信息请关注PHP中文网其他相关文章!

本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板